🦴 Single Leg Bridge

Bridge with one leg lifted to focus on single-side glute strength.

HipIntermediateMat3 × 10

How to do the Single Leg Bridge

  1. Lie on your back with both knees bent
  2. Lift one leg straight up, keep it extended
  3. Drive through the planted heel to lift hips
  4. Keep hips level (no dropping)
  5. Hold 3 seconds, lower with control

Form tips

  • Don't let hips tilt
  • Squeeze the planted glute hard

Muscles worked

Glutes, Hamstrings, Core

When to be cautious

  • Hamstring cramping
